Adobe推出DATENeRF,它用于基于文本编辑NeRF(神经辐射场)场景。NeRF是一种可以创建和渲染3D环境的技术,它通过从2D图像中重建场景的3D表示来实现。DATENeRF的关键特点是它能够利用场景的深度信息来指导基于文本的图像编辑,从而在保持视角一致性的同时,实现更真实和详细的编辑结果。
例如,如果你有一个3D场景的NeRF表示,并且想要将场景中的一只老鼠编辑成一只穿着礼服的老鼠,你可以使用DATENeRF来实现这一编辑。首先,系统会根据NeRF的深度信息生成一个初始的2D图像编辑,然后通过深度感知的ControlNet来改善编辑的一致性。接着,系统会将这个编辑结果投影到其他视角,并使用混合修复技术来生成一系列视角一致的编辑图像。最终,这些编辑图像将被整合到NeRF模型中,从而得到一个在所有视角下都看起来一致和真实的3D场景。
主要功能和特点:
- 深度感知编辑: DATENeRF使用NeRF场景的深度信息来改善2D图像编辑的一致性,使得编辑后的图像在不同视角下看起来更加自然和连贯。
- 文本驱动的编辑: 用户可以通过输入文本提示来指导编辑过程,例如将“一只斑马”更改为“一只穿着老虎条纹的斑马”。
- 视角一致性: 通过深度信息和投影修复技术,DATENeRF能够在多个视角下生成一致的编辑结果,避免了传统方法中可能出现的模糊纹理和几何错误。
工作原理:
DATENeRF首先使用NeRF技术重建3D场景,然后根据用户指定的区域和文本提示,使用基于扩散的生成模型(如Stable Diffusion)对每个视角的2D图像进行编辑。为了提高编辑的一致性,它使用深度条件控制网络(ControlNet)来对编辑后的图像进行处理。接下来,通过将一个视角的编辑结果投影到其他视角,并结合混合修复技术,DATENeRF能够生成一系列在视角上保持一致的编辑图像。最后,通过优化NeRF模型,将这些编辑整合到最终的3D场景中。
具体应用场景:
- 电影和游戏制作: DATENeRF可以用于创建和编辑电影或游戏中的3D场景,提供更高质量的视觉效果。
- 虚拟现实和增强现实: 在VR和AR应用中,DATENeRF可以用来生成和修改3D环境,提供更加丰富和逼真的用户体验。
- 艺术创作: 艺术家可以使用DATENeRF来创作3D艺术作品,通过文本提示来实现复杂的场景编辑和风格化表达。
- 3D建模和设计: 设计师可以利用DATENeRF对3D模型进行详细的纹理和材质编辑,无需复杂的3D建模软件。
0条评论